**Q: What happens if the Taxline rate cache in Pellwood fails to warm before a release cut?**

A: The deploy gate blocks until the cache reports ready. If it stalls past ten minutes, restart the warmer job and re-run the gate. Should the warmer's vault be sealed, you'll need the recovery passphrase, which is:

unlock words, kajef-kadug: sorys-pelax-lamael-tamvan-briiel-novdor-fenwyn-tamdor-oliion-keleth-julok-belion-ralok

Subject: Falconbridge Plant Capacity — Decision Context

Dear Heads of Department,

Following careful analysis, we have concluded that extending the second shift at the Falconbridge plant is preferable to commissioning Line 4 this year. The capital deferral preserves roughly a quarter's contingency, while overtime costs remain within tolerance through peak season. A full options paper will follow. Please treat the planning note directly below as strictly confidential.

internal memo for kaduf-baduf: Only 35 of the 378 pilot accounts renewed Holir, so a churn review is set for June 11. Eliielax Group is in early talks to buy Silaelix Group for about $142.1 million.

Finance Review Summary — Customer Concentration, Verelux Group

Revenue concentration remains elevated: the Dunmoor account represents 31% of recurring income, up from 26% last year. Two further accounts together add 18%. Contract renewal timing clusters in the second quarter, compounding exposure. Heads of department should factor this into hiring and inventory commitments. Mitigation options are under review, and the confidential note below sets out the plan.

internal memo for faweg-hahip: Silokix Works plans to lower the Tamvan list price by 8 percent in June.

Quick map for support folks working the cron drift investigation. Chronoscope runs in three environments: dev (chaotic, ignore alerts from it), staging (mirrors prod schedules but on the Veldmark cluster, which has the suspect clock source), and prod. The drift we're chasing only reproduces in staging, so that's where the investigation tooling lives — extra tick logging, NTP comparison probes, the works. Don't copy staging settings to prod without checking with the platform folks first. Staging's current configuration is below.

settings of bafop-bawep:
druwyn:
  pin: 6243
  metrics_host: metrics.druwyn.zemvarlabs.internal
  tenant: istir
  seal: seal_be290ddb